Bright gold in the glass with some pretty intense chill haze. Half a finger white head that drops quickly leaving webby lacing. The aroma is all grainy malty with a little hop underneath. The taste follows the aroma, with a really strong unfermented wort taste. Thick and chewy with a sweet, cereal twang. Neither dry nor refreshing; neither substantive nor rich. Just kinda strange...
I imagine these guys are still tweaking their system and getting into the swing of things (although they have been opened for a few months already), and I will give them another shot over the winter to see some of their other beers, but this was a mess. I couldn't finish it for all my trying. Regardless, this area of town needed a brewery so hopefully they'll do well.
